#78e780 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#78e780 is composed of 47.1% red, 90.6%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 44.6% yellow and 9.4% black. It has a hue angle of 124.3 degrees, a saturation of 69.8% and a lightness of 68.8%. #78e780 color hex could be obtained by blending #f0ffff with #00cf01. Closest websafe color is: #66ff99.

#78e780 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#78e780 has RGB values of R:120, G:231,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0.48, M:0, Y:0.45,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 7923584.

Hex triplet 78e780 #78e780
RGB Decimal 120, 231, 128 rgb(120,231,128)
RGB Percent 47.1, 90.6, 50.2 rgb(47.1%,90.6%,50.2%)
CMYK 48, 0, 45, 9
HSL 124.3°, 69.8, 68.8 hsl(124.3,69.8%,68.8%)
HSV (or HSB) 124.3°, 48.1, 90.6
Web Safe 66ff99 #66ff99
CIE-LAB 83.285, -52.584, 40.457
XYZ 40.216, 62.701, 30.404
xyY 0.302, 0.47, 62.701
CIE-LCH 83.285, 66.346, 142.426
CIE-LUV 83.285, -51.723, 62.904
Hunter-Lab 79.184, -47.915, 32.663
Binary 01111000, 11100111, 10000000

Shades and Tints of #78e780

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030f04 is the darkest color, while #fdfff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#78e780

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#afb0af is the less saturated color, while #66f970 is the most saturated one.
